To investigate the diameter of trees in a woodlot the line transect method was used. Students conducted the investigation in the Danby Woods behind the reserved Chimneystack Road Parking Lot at York University (York Blvd and Keele Street; 43.7° N, 79.5 ° W) at 3:30pm. It was 26°C and pleasantly sunny. The woodlot was very dry and appeared to be withering. Using transect measuring tape, a student walked in a straight line from one edge of the woodlot to the centre of the woodlot to measure the distance between these two points. The distance between the edge of the woodlot and the centre of the woodlot was measured and recorded as 750 cm. By observation, 10 pairs of trees were counted along this transect line of 750 cm. Using measuring tape, the distance from one tree to another tree (in a pair) was recorded in the notebook. The condition of each tree was observed and also recorded. A dead tree was recorded as 0, a living tree as 1, and a huge green canopy as 2. In addition, the diameter of the tree at breast height (dbh) was measured using measuring tape. It took one hour to record the distance between 10 pairs of trees, the diameter at breast height of each tree and the condition of each tree. The duration of the experiment was 1 hour and 30 minutes. It was hypothesized that the distance between trees would be greater than one meter because large trees are usually spaced far apart due to the elongation of their branches. In addition, it was hypothesized that the trees would have a diameter greater than 30 cm and that most of the trees would form huge green canopies because the investigation was conducted in the woods.
